The Essentials of Metal Polishing - Most often, the finishing of metal is important for aesthetics as well as clean-room application. It really is among the most prominent processes simply because of its usefulness in intensifying the overall attractiveness of the items, such as, motor bike parts, automotive parts or cookware. Also, a good number of clean-rooms will require a sleek finish so as to minimize the porosity of the metal surfaces which may result in particles to gather and contaminate. A great instance of this application would be in vacuum chambers.

There exist numerous strategies to polish metals, and let us have a quick look at a number of the techniques required. Metal may be finished by hand, using special buffing machines, electromechanically or chemically. A particular polishing compound or paste is commonly applied, which may incorporate aluminum oxide, limestone, chromium oxide, tripoli, chalk, dolomite, or iron oxide.

Finishing stainless steel, because of its lousy thermal conductivity, reasonably high viscosity, and hardness is among the most time intensive. However, items manufactured from non-ferrous metal are often more amenable to finishing, since they need the lowest amount of treatments.

Polishing buffs smothered in paste will be substantially affected by specific force on the surface of the polishing pad. The concentration of the pressure on the surface could be elevated to a chosen level, although further overreaching the most effective degree of force not only minimizes the quality level of the process, but in addition degrades efficiency, may cause wear to the part, and furthermore a conspicuous overheating of the work-pieces, as a result of friction. When working thin metal, it is greater temperature (and the resulting pliability of the material) that cause parts to bend, twist or flex. For the most part, it needs an educated polisher to factor in every one of these elements to equally not cause damage to the piece and to give good results effectively. To be able to appreciably enhance the quality of the resulting surface area, the buffing procedure must be completed with reduced vigour and not a large amount of force to be able to finally deliver a surface area with no scratches or fine lines resulting from the polishing process, thus arriving at a fantastic mirror finish.
